Characters and Skills
A nack for talent in building characters and knowledge about skills. You give the best advice you can, but understand people still want to do things their own way. Stickied guides should have uniform, organized titles even if you have to edit them. You can spot a good guide among the average posts, and don't mind helping keep this forum organized.
Guides and Tutorials
Your a neat freak. Good content must be organized, stickied and updated. Quest guides and other materials should be updated as new information is found. I know of at least 2 or 3 posts that need a sticky already. Titles should be organized and proper, even if you have to edit them. This forum needs an incredible amount of love.

Not entirely.
Whenever someone posts about it, or PMs me, I post about it in the administration forum.
There it is discussed. Its not entirely 'first come first serve'.
The process itself, I always seem to drag my feet for unreasonable amounts of time. The biggest reason is because I am weary of putting anyone in a position of power that A) Affects the overall image of SRF B) giving people power to delete anything on the board and C) worry about how they address other people.
In this particular case, there were some RL issues and I did wait a bit.
